要使用GitHub,那么首先就要会玩Git,Git可以说是开启GitHub的钥匙
配置git本地配置
git config --global user.name 你的名字
git config --global user.email 你的邮箱(随便填写,不一定就是github邮箱)
git config --global push.default simple
git config --global core.quotepath false
git config --global core.editor "code --wait" # code就是vscode
git config --global core.autocrlf input
Git常用命令
- git init #初始化一个本地空仓库
- git add 路径或文件 #选择需要提交的文件或目录
- git commint -m 提交的备注信息 #提交变动并填写变动信息
- git status #查看当前的git状态
- git status --sb #以简短的形式显示git的状态
- git log #查看提交的日志
- git reflog #查看版本回滚或切换后的日志
- git reset --hard xxx #回滚代码到指定的版本
- git branch xxx #创建一个新的分支
- git checkout xxx #切换到指定的分支
- git branch #显示当前的分支列表
- git stash #暂存已git add的代码
- git stash pop #恢复暂存在的代码
- git merge 分支名 #将指定的分支合并到当前的分支
- git branch -D 分支名 #删除指定的分支
Git的冲突解决
- git status --sb 查看哪些文件有异常
- 依次打开每个文件
- 搜索 ==== 四个等号
- 等于号上面的为当前分支的代码,等号下面的为合并后的代码
- 删除等于号,删除多余不用的代码
- git add 修改后的文件
- 重复以上步骤,直到冲突解决完成
- git commit 不加参数,提交冲突变动